Output 20ecaa1000b148eb537535edd4b702bdc5f04113b2f85ac5d891ee0fae8cca32:1

value
16832880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c438db5730bc5cb736ba031c2bfcd5a23c98e4dc OP_EQUAL
address
3KaYUd3GEKp2MmvVufXLXF9jgMcnXW7kMF
transaction
20ecaa1000b148eb537535edd4b702bdc5f04113b2f85ac5d891ee0fae8cca32
spent
true